Calling a Sybase Stored procedure from a UNIX Script

Hi, I am new to shell scripting and Sybase database i need a help that i try to execute a SYBASE stored procedure from a Unix shell script and wanna write the output of the SP into a Text File.somehow i try to find a solution but whwn i try to run the script i am not getting the output file with the desired records. i have created the input file "test.sql" which executes the SP and all the server details and input output file details are in ".SH file" i have the Output file also in the same location. i tried to execute the SP in rapid sql and found that the SP works well. and i dont have input parameters here.

Please correct me if i am wrong anywhere. and this is an Urgent requirement.

.SH FILE :
#!/bin/ksh -x

isql -S${Servername} -D${Database name } -I$ test.Sql -O$ Outfile.OUT -U${username} -P${password}

INPUT FILE: test.sql

use BenefitDB
go

exec Sample_SP
go

Apache::Session::Store::Sybase - Store persistent data in a Sybase database SYNOPSIS
use Apache::Session::Store::Sybase; my $store = new Apache::Session::Store::MySQL; $store->insert( $ref ); $store->update( $ref ); $store->materialize( $ref ); $store->remove( $ref ); DESCRIPTION
Apache::Session::Store::Sybase fulfills the storage interface of Apache::Session. Session data is stored in a Sybase database. SCHEMA
To use this module, you will need at least these columns in a table called 'sessions': id CHAR(32) # or however long your session IDs are. a_session IMAGE To create this schema, you can execute this command using the isql or sqsh programs: CREATE TABLE sessions ( id CHAR(32) not null primary key, a_session TEXT ) go If you use some other command, ensure that there is a unique index on the id column of the table CONFIGURATION
The module must know what datasource, username, and password to use when connecting to the database. These values can be set using the options hash (see Apache::Session documentation). The options are: DataSource UserName Password Example: tie %hash, 'Apache::Session::Sybase', $id, { DataSource => 'dbi:Sybase:database=db;server=server', UserName => 'database_user', Password => 'K00l', Commit => 1, }; Instead, you may pass in an already-opened DBI handle to your database. tie %hash, 'Apache::Session::Sybase', $id, { Handle => $dbh }; Additional arguments you can pass to the backing store are: Commit - whether we should commit any changes; if you pass in an already-open database handle that has AutoCommit set to a true value, you do not need to set this. If you let Apache::Session::Store::Sybase create your database, handle, you must set this to a true value, otherwise, your changes will not be saved textsize - the value we should pass to the 'set textsize ' command that sets the max size of the IMAGE field. Default is 32K (at least in Sybase ASE 11.9.2). AUTHOR
